Beaches – Lawrenceville, Virginia
The Virginia portion of this lake is primarily in Brunswick County, just below Buggs Island Lake (Virginia licenses are legal lake-wide). This 20,300-acre reservoir is 34 miles long and has 350 miles of shoreline. Lake Gaston has ... More on AnglerWeb.com

Parks – Greensboro, North Carolina
Inscription. First air mail flight through N. C. landed here May 1, 1928. Charles Lindbergh, on Oct. 14, 1927, landed nearby to open field. , Erected 1979 by North Carolina Office of Archives and History. (Marker Number J-77: ), ... More on HMDB
